Spurs have long been haunted by St Totteringham's Day, but their star striker looks to put an end to this.

Tottenham Hotspur have not finished ahead of north London rivals Arsenal in the league in 20 years, but the 2015/16 season could see that awful run come to an end, as Spurs sit two points ahead of the Gunners with one more round left to play.

This has star White Hart Lane striker Harry Kane excited, as the Three Lions forward admitted to Spurs correspondent Ben Pearce that he’s eager to deliver a second-placed finish to the fans, though he confessed his disappointment in seeing his side fail to win the league crown.

Kane said: “We definitely want to finish second, that is our aim. It would be a blow [to come third] but we go to Newcastle and we are still backing ourselves to win that game. It hurts not finishing it off at home but we have still got one more game.

“It would be a very good thing [to finish above Arsenal]. It’s not something I think we all focused on at the start of the season, but now we are here it would be good.

“It would be good for the fans to have those bragging rights for the first time in a long time. It’s in our hands, we have just got to win the next game and the job will be done.”

Given the bitter rivalry between Tottenham and Arsenal, St Totteringham's Day – the occasion that marks the Gunners finish ahead of Spurs – is widely celebrated by Gooners, and used to troll their neighbors.

Although Mauricio Pochettino’s crew are in the driving seat to finish ahead of Wenger’s boys, their 2-1 defeat to Southampton on Sunday handed Arsenal fans fresh hope of enjoying St Totteringham's Day this season.

However, this will require Tottenham – who narrowly missed out on the title to Leicester – to lose at St. James’ Park, with Arsenal needing victory in their home clash with Aston Villa on the final day.
